Font Size: a A A

Study Of Coordinative Service Bus Based Service Execution Environment And Its Implementation

Posted on:2011-12-24Degree:MasterType:Thesis
Country:ChinaCandidate:K YuFull Text:PDF
GTID:2178360308462415Subject:Computer Science and Technology
Abstract/Summary:
Under the environment of network convergence, SEE(Service Execution Envrionment) is not only to provide value-added Application execution environment, but also provide diversified, multimedia integrated and personalized synthetic service, and can provide open-ended, wide-area distributed coordinative and integrative ability of collaborative application operation. So this paper propose a kind of coordinative services based service execution environment(CSB-SEE).Firstly this paper introduces the background of enterprise service bus(ESB) based New Generation Operations Systems and Software (NGOSS), and then introduces and analyze the important technology of building the system:Agent, ICE middleware, interceptors and etc.Then determines the main two parts of the the system:Single Point Execution and Area Coordination. Through using the method of Attribute-Driven Design, analyses the function and quality attributes of the system, then determines the whole software architecture.For Single Point Execution, uses the message business, and makes the communication between applications and plugins became flexible and effective. And applies Interceptors into plugin, which will make the plugin can not only provide extra abilities, but also can get deep informations of the applications, network environment and the platform, and these informations can be shared through the coordinative service bus.For Area Coordination, designs the architecture, implementation and the mechanism of CSB using the technology of ESB, Agent and ICE, then makes CSB and SEE combinded together. And CSB divides the problem of distributed collaboration into some areas and parts, then through the collaboration of regional and classifical service bus nodes and the service execution nodes with agent, last achieves fast combination of services.Finally, from the aspect of application management, the plugin loading instantiation, the cooperation of plug-ins and applications, initialization of CSB, the combination services through collaboration of CSB and service execution nodes, this paper demonstrates each major functions of the running mechanism of the framework. Finally introduced testing methods and method. At the end of the paper is summarise, and further research work introduction.
Keywords/Search Tags:CSB, SOA, ESB, Agent, ICE, interceptor
Related items